        "Description": "ESA's Planetary Science Archive (PSA) is the central repository\nfor all scientific and engineering data returned by ESA's Solar System missions:\nas of June, 2012, Giotto, Huygens, Mars Express, Rosetta, SMART-1, and Venus\nExpress, as well as several ground-based cometary observations.  The PSA uses\nNASA's Planetary Data System standards as a baseline for the formatting and\nstructure of all data within the archive.  PSA is located at the European Space\nAstronomy Center near Madrid, Spain.",
